How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Central Alameda?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Central Alameda Studio Apartments | $2,906 | $1,925 | $5,053 |
| Central Alameda 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,041 | $1,600 | $10,000+ |
| Central Alameda 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,459 | $2,175 | $5,145 |
| Central Alameda 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,548 | $3,200 | $3,995 |
| Central Alameda 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,816 | $4,600 | $5,000 |
